Milvus milvus. This magnificently graceful bird of prey is unmistakable with its reddish-brown body, angled wings and deeply forked tail. It was saved from national extinction by one of the world's longest running protection programmes, and has now been successfully re-introduced to England and Scotland. This kite was photographed over the Welsh countryside where they are a beautiful sight to behold. The Ruby-throated Hummingbird is one of the smallest of birds. They can hover in mid-air by rapidly flapping their wings. They can also fly backwards, and are the only group of birds able to do so. Their name derives from the characteristic hum made by their rapid wing beats. This note card features a hummingbird on a branch, silhouetted against a lovely blue sky.
